Victoria Saha Education
The news reporter attended Hills High School in her hometown. Afterward, she joined Quinnipiac University, a private university in Hamden, Connecticut. From there, she received a Bachelor of Arts degree in Broadcast Journalism in 2017.

KLAS Channel 8 News
KLAS Channel 8 News is a television station in Las Vegas, Nevada, United States. It is affiliated with CBS News. It is known that Nexstar Media Group owns it.
Victoria is a vastly recognized journalist working for KLAS Channel 8 News in Queens County, NY. Here, she serves as a news reporter for the 8 News Now newscasts.
Initially, she joined the station as a multimedia journalist before transitioning to the position of reporter. Before this, she worked as a reporter at WAOW News in Wausau, WI.
Most noteworthy, she was hired by Q30 Television where she served as a news correspondent. During this time, she served as the co-host of #That news show.
It is also known that Saha did an internship in the WTNH-TV assignment desk department in New Haven, CT. Furthermore, she worked as a radio host for the ‘Desi Beats’ weekly radio show at WQAQ 98.1FM.
